BMS Digital Safety: Protecting Your Building's Core

A secure Building Management System (BMS) is vital for modern buildings, but its digital infrastructure is frequently becoming a point for cyberattacks . Protecting your BMS by unauthorized access demands a comprehensive approach to cybersecurity . This includes deploying strong authentication measures, periodically patching software, and creating clear security protocols to shield your building's essential functions and private data .

Navigating BMS Digital Safety Challenges and Solutions

The rise of Building Management Systems (BMS) and their increasing integration on networked technologies presents considerable safety vulnerabilities. Protecting critical infrastructure from malicious activity requires a preventative approach. Common issues include weak authentication methods , outdated software, and a shortage of employee education . Solutions involve implementing robust access controls, regularly updating firmware and systems, conducting security assessments, and fostering a environment of digital security . Furthermore, establishing incident response plans and leveraging advanced analysis tools are crucial for mitigating potential damage and maintaining operational resilience .
